Pairing Glomer Dotejon with Body Copy for Optimal Readability

While Glomer Dotejon excels as a display font, understanding how to pair it correctly is crucial for maintaining a harmonious layout. As a bold serif, it pairs exceptionally well with clean sans-serif fonts for captions, navigation menus, and UI elements, creating a modern contrast that keeps the design feeling fresh. For body copy, pairing it with a highly readable, neutral serif or a humanist sans-serif ensures that the text remains comfortable for extended reading sessions. This strategic font pairing supports visual rhythm and prevents the design from becoming overwhelming. Editors should consider testing these combinations in both digital formats and PDF exports to ensure that the hierarchy remains intact when readers switch between desktop and mobile views. The goal is to let Glomer Dotejon shine in headings and key messages while supporting the underlying text with complementary typefaces.
